Dr. Resul Umit is an Associate Professor in Comparative Politics at the School of Government and International Affairs, Durham University. His research focuses on electoral representation, energy and climate politics, and methodological innovations in causal inference, textual analysis, and survey methodology.
- Education: PhD in Political Science (2017) from the University of Vienna, funded by the Institute for Advanced Studies. Postdoctoral roles at the University of Lucerne and the University of Oslo.
- Key Research Areas: Electoral behavior, legislative accountability, climate policy, and public communication.
- Teaching & Tools: Conducted workshops on R programming, web scraping, and Twitter data analysis. Developed tools like the psjournals app for political science journal metrics.
Article Trends: His recent publications analyze EU media coverage, legislative dissent, climate policy perceptions, and renewable energy acceptance. Methodologically, they emphasize data-driven causal analysis and cross-national comparisons.
Scientific Recognition:
- 2024: Advance HE Fellowship
- 2021: Journal of Contemporary European Studies Prize (co-authored with Dr. Katrin Auel)
- 2020: Teaching and Learning Certificate (University of Oslo)
- 2015: PADEMIA Student Paper Award
Supervision: Dr. Umit welcomes PhD inquiries in Comparative Politics, specifically in Representation, Public Opinion, Electoral Behavior, and Environmental Politics.
